## Step 4: Dedupe customer records

Before cutting over to Ledgerline, run the dedupe pass so we don't drag thousands of duplicate customer rows into the new schema. The matcher uses fuzzy name plus normalized postal fields — good enough, not perfect, so eyeball the merge report. The matcher reads its thresholds from the settings below.

deployment values, faduf-tawep:
SORDOR_LOG_LEVEL=error
SORDOR_METRICS_HOST=metrics.sordor.nelvrolabs.internal
SORDOR_POOL_SIZE=4

// Parcel-tracking webhook client setup.
// Crateline pushes delivery-scan events to our Wrenpost ingest
// endpoint; this client registers the webhook and verifies
// signatures on each payload. Registration is idempotent, so
// re-running setup on deploy is safe. Note for the eng sync:
// retry backoff is capped at five minutes pending the queue
// migration. The registration call authenticates against the
// internal Wrenpost admin service using the key below.

gateway credential: kto23_LX9A4ys6i4nzHtpOLNLodKK

Account Recovery — Pagewright Static Builds

If a customer loses access to their Pagewright dashboard, incremental rebuilds of their static site will continue from the last known-good deploy, so no content is lost during recovery. Confirm the customer's last rebuild timestamp in the Orlin console, then initiate the recovery flow from the admin panel. Do not trigger a full rebuild until access is restored. Unlocking the recovery flow requires the passphrase below.

recovery phrase for yadup-taguf: wenael-quenox-kelix

Finance Review Summary — Capacity Call, Drossel Mills

Sales leads, quick summary: we're greenlighting the second line at the Ferncastle plant rather than outsourcing overflow. Payback looks like roughly 26 months at current volumes. Lead times should drop by three weeks once it's running. Keep quoting current timelines until confirmed. The plan behind this decision is laid out below.

internal memo for kaduf-baduf: Only 35 of the 378 pilot accounts renewed Holir, so a churn review is set for June 11. Eliielax Group is in early talks to buy Silaelix Group for about $142.1 million.